Enterprise Solutions Engineer - Fresenius Medical Care (Lowell)

Employment Type

: Full-Time


: Healthcare - Allied Health

Loading some great jobs for you...

Position Specific Details

Expw/full stack design/programming languages, (Java,Python, C#, C++, scripting, OO). Understand scalable, cloud architectures (AWS, Azure,Puppet, Docker, Google Cloud). Exp using API's to tie togethermultiple systems/data sources.Expw/relational/ NoSQL db's (Oracle, SQL Server, MySQL, MongoDB).Exp w/APIs, integrationtechnologies to tie together multiple systems/data sources.Mobile/iOS/Android development expand healthcare interoperability standards (HL7, CCDA, FHIR) a plus. Workingknowledge of Agile, DevOps, and microservices based applications a plus.


Position is in the Fresenius Medical Care (FMC) IT Technology Integration Group that focuses on researching new technologies, bring new technologies to realization, and creating technology standards. As a hands-on Technical Solutions Engineer, candidate will be responsible for independently researching and selecting new technologies, selecting best alternatives, creating prototypes, running pilots, and presenting findings and recommendations to both technical and business audiences. The role requires an understanding of a variety of technologies (application, languages, infrastructure) with the ability and motivation to learn just in time to support assignments. Collaborates across business and IT organizations to articulate technical alternatives and builds consensus. Supports FMCNAs mission, vision, core values and customer service philosophy. Adheres to the FMCNA Compliance Program, including following all regulatory and division/company policy requirements.


Technical Research and Prototypes:

  • Work with business/IT to understand needs, document technical requirements, define/document/share technical alternatives, create high-level proposals to make use of best alternatives.
  • Perform industry research to determine what products and components can be leveraged to fill needs, determine if there are best practices to follow, help business and technical audience understand state of offerings, determine the state of a new technology FMC is interested in.
  • Perform and lead technical solution searches, proof of concepts, and selection of best solution.
  • Continually look for new technologies that can help FMC fill future needs, provide more scalability and interoperability, improve speed to delivery, and avoid application/data silos. Help cultivate awareness and opportunities for new technologies.
  • Present findings to technical peers at an Architecture Review Board (ARB).
  • Assist FMC in assessing the maturity of a new technology and make recommendations in how to use it.
  • Contribute to the creation of technology blueprints, frameworks, solutions that can be leveraged by others.
  • For larger efforts, lead cross-functional IT and business teams to determine needs and alternatives, run pilots, and communicate technology decisions.
  • When researching technologies, take into consideration scalability, performance, infrastructure, and match to FMC technology stack when making recommendations.
  • Technical Execution

  • Produce accurate, unambiguous technical documents and presentations to the appropriate detail.
  • Build prototypes and proof of concepts to promote new technologies.
  • Propose solutions to meet business need and aid in estimating for new technologies being adopted.
  • Coordination, Communication, Coach

  • Define and communicate (in ways each audience understands) technical solution, pros, and cons.
  • Coach and knowledge transfer to those that adopt the new technologies recommended.
  • Help implementation teams get started by assisting in the definition of Agile epics and stories.
  • Perform other duties as specified by supervisor.

  • Qualifications


  • The physical demands and work environment characteristics described here are representative of those an employee encounters while performing the essential functions of this job. Reasonable accommodations may be made to enable individuals with disabilities to perform the essential functions.

  • 8-10 years of experience as a hands-on software technical lead or senior software engineer.
  • Bachelors degree required in computer science or related engineering field. Masters degree preferred.

  • Experience with full stack design and projects.
  • Exceptional communication and collaboration skills, with the ability to present and discuss technical information in a way that establishes rapport, persuades others, and provides understanding to a diverse audience (developers to executives)
  • Able to work on multiple projects, with multiple audiences and deadlines.
  • Understanding of scalable, cloud architectures such as AWS, Azure, Puppet, Docker, Google Cloud, and experience in applying them to real world problems.
  • Experience with current programming languages and the ability to pick up others just in time. For example, Java, Python, C#, C++, scripting, object-oriented.
  • Experience using APIs, integration technologies to tie together multiple systems/data sources.
  • Experience with relational and NoSQL databases like Oracle, SQL Server, MySQL, MongoDB.
  • Experience working within a complex software/system environment.
  • Mobile development experience a plus - iOS, Android.
  • Knowledge of healthcare interoperability standards (HL7, CCDA, FHIR) a plus.
  • Working knowledge of Agile, DevOps, and microservices based applications a plus.
  • EO/AA Employer: Minorities/Females/Veterans/Disability/Sexual Orientation/Gender Identity

    Fresenius Medical Care North America maintains a drug-free workplace in accordance with applicable federal and state laws.

    Associated topics: ascp, lab, medical, medical laboratory science, medical technologist, mls, pathology, sample collection, services, technician lab

    Launch your career - Create your profile now!

    Create your Profile

    Loading some great jobs for you...